We are Aspire Living & Learning, a non-profit human services agency making a meaningful difference in the lives of adults and children with autism and other disabilities.

Aspire Living & Learning is currently seeking a a Help Desk Systems Specialist to ensure the smooth operation and security of our computer network, hardware, and software. This role involves providing remote technical support, troubleshooting services, and user training while maintaining a secure IT environment. The position offers a hybrid work arrangement, allowing flexibility between remote work, on-site support, and office-based tasks.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Respond promptly to user inquiries and technical issues, offering efficient solutions and temporary fixes when necessary.
  • Provide training and support to users on standard software applications and hardware, both individually and in group settings.
  • Collaborate with department staff and vendors to diagnose and resolve software and data-related issues.
  • Install, configure, troubleshoot, and support PC hardware, software, and peripherals.
  • Manage Information Systems projects, including needs assessments, research, and evaluation.
  • Generate activity and project status reports as required.
Qualifications:
  • Associate degree in computer engineering or relevant field, or equivalent experience.
  • 2+ years of experience in user support with a focus on customer service.
  • Proficiency with Windows, iOS, and OSX operating systems.
  • 1+ years of experience in cloud computing, specifically Microsoft Azure.
  • 2+ years of experience working with PC hardware, operations, and configuration.
  • Knowledge of computer network operating systems, internet technologies, and troubleshooting methods.
  • Familiarity with training and instruction techniques in a professional environment.
Working Conditions:
  • Professional office environment with hybrid work arrangements.
  • Occasional travel to group homes and state offices may be required.
  • Ability to lift/carry up to 10 pounds and perform various physical tasks.
  • Routine use of standard office equipment such as computers, phones, and audio/visual equipment.
